WebThe Product Rule states that the product of two or more numbers raised to a power is equal to the product of each number raised to the same power. The same is true of roots: x√ab = x√a⋅ x√b a b x = a x ⋅ b x. When dividing radical expressions, the rules governing quotients are similar: x√a b = x√a x√b a b x = a x b x. WebTo divide two radicals, you can first rewrite the problem as one radical. The two numbers inside the square roots can be combined as a fraction inside just one square root. WebIf two radicals are in division with the same index, you can take the radical once and divide the numbers inside the radicals. Unit test Test your knowledge of all skills in this ... golden glow by telefloraWebA common way of dividing the radical expression is to have the denominator that contain no radicals. Dividing radical is based on rationalizing the denominator. Rationalizing is the process of starting with a fraction containing a radical in its denominator and determining fraction with no radical in its denominator. hdfc ifsc code hdfc0000545
